# Kirin Chess Engine
[](https://opensource.org/licenses/)
The original Kirin Chess Engine was written in C and the source code is available [here](https://github.com/strvdr/kirin-ce). I have since deprecated this project and am now writing the Kirin Chess Engine in Zig.

## Roadmap
- Bitboard board representation ✅
- Pre-calculated attack tables ✅
- Magic bitboards ✅
- Encoding moves as a packed struct ✅
- Copy/make approach for making moves ✅
- Pseudolegal move generation with immediate legality testing ✅
- Negamax search with alpha beta pruning
- PV/killer/history move ordering
- Iterative deepening
- PVS (Principle Variation Search)
- LMR (Late Move Reduction)
- NMP (Null Move Pruning)
- Razoring
- Evaluation pruning / static null move pruning
- Transposition table (up to 128MB)
- PURE Stockfish NNUE evaluation + 50 move rule penalty
- UCI protocol
## Usage
Zig is a new programming language that hasn't reached v1.0 at the time of writing this. Because of this, development of the Zig language is constantly ongoing. I currently use the [Zig Nightly AUR package](https://aur.archlinux.org/packages/zig-nightly-bin) which is being consistently updated. There is also a [homebrew](https://github.com/vvvvv/homebrew-zig) version of the nightly bin for Mac users.
The Zig build system is super robust and easy to use, here are a few commands you can run, with more to be added down the road:
```zig
zig build # Build the project
zig build run # Run Kirin Chess
zig build test # Run tests
zig build perft # Run perft tests
zig build magic # Generate magic numbers
```
